Method/Apparatus/Procedure:
In a tube 1 cm diameter and 12 cm long known amount, by weight, of hydrocarbon and water were placed into a temperature controlled bath. The contents of the tube were stirred and alcohol was added gradually until a homogeneous solution was obtained. Observations were made visually through the telescope of a cathetometer. The samples were always weighed immediately before and after each experiment. Concentrations were reported as weight of water in 1 g of binary water-hydrocarbon mixture and the weight of alcohol necessary to make a homogenous solution. The mass of binary water-hydrocarbon mixture was about 1 g; the mass of alcohol-up to 5 g.

Components:
- Ethanol, $\ce{ C2H6O }$; [64-17-5] NIST WebBook
- 1,2-Dimethylbenzene, $\ce{ C8H10 }$; [95-47-6] NIST WebBook
- Water, $\ce{ H2O }$; [7732-18-5] NIST WebBook
Experimental Data
Compositions along the saturation curve
| $T$ (°C) | $T$ ($\pu{K}$) | w1 | w2 | $x_{1}$ | $x_{2}$ |
|---|---|---|---|---|---|
| 0.0 | 273.2 | 0.2604 | 0.7182 | 0.4153 | 0.4972 |
| 0.0 | 273.2 | 0.3464 | 0.6275 | 0.5053 | 0.3972 |
| 0.0 | 273.2 | 0.5181 | 0.4198 | 0.6030 | 0.2120 |
| 0.0 | 273.2 | 0.5690 | 0.3388 | 0.5977 | 0.1544 |
| 0.0 | 273.2 | 0.6094 | 0.2687 | 0.5873 | 0.1124 |
| 0.0 | 273.2 | 0.6485 | 0.1814 | 0.5580 | 0.0677 |
| 0.0 | 273.2 | 0.6616 | 0.1259 | 0.5252 | 0.0434 |
| 0.0 | 273.2 | 0.6445 | 0.0739 | 0.4615 | 0.0230 |
| 0.0 | 273.2 | 0.6212 | 0.0379 | 0.4116 | 0.0109 |
| 0.0 | 273.2 | 0.5434 | 0.0142 | 0.3232 | 3.7 x 10-3 |
